Spider-Man the game: PS4 Release Date Confirmed

Once again, back to Spider-Man and Insomniac Games. By knowing that Spider-Man is probably the most anticipated PS4 exclusives of 2018, the release date reveal is more likely to surprise every PlayStation user.

The Digital Issue is now live, and with it, the release date has come as well. All PS4 players will be able to play with their favorite Marvel’s superhero, Spider-Man, on September 7, 2018. Sadly, Xbox users won’t have any chance of participating the fun and excitement this game brings.

After its reveal at E3 2016, rumors have been whirling around how the story mode will immerse the players and keep them put in the game for a more extended period than any other previous series. As you know, we have already told you that the game will offer a vast Open World, with a collision between Peter Parker and Spider-Man’s world.

The Open World, as stated by Insomniac Games, shall contribute to a whole new sort of showcasing a story through players’ monitors. Therefore, it shouldn’t be tied to any movie. After the publishing of the new PS4 gameplay trailer, it is more than obvious the combat mechanics are on a whole new level. Players will be able to use the environment as an advantage to destroy their opponent.

Once again, the PS4 version of the game comes out on September 7, 2018.
